Patent number: 9339648Abstract: Methods and systems are disclosed for determining the timing of stimulation applied using a medical device. In embodiments, the medical device filters a received signal to obtain a plurality of band-pass filtered signals, each corresponding to one or more stimulation channels. The medical device then determines the envelopes of these band-pass filtered signals. Next, the medical device determines the stimulation timing (i.e., the pulse times) for the corresponding stimulation channel based on the timing of a particular phase (e.g., a peak, a minimum, etc.) of the envelope. A pulse amplitude for the stimulation channel may then be determined, and stimulation applied using the determined amplitude and pulse time.Type: GrantFiled: January 28, 2014Date of Patent: May 17, 2016Assignee: Cochlear LimitedInventor: Zachary Mark Smith

Publication number: 20160081878Abstract: Medical devices including a vial adapter with an inline dry drug module for use with a vial, a needleless syringe and a carrier liquid for filling the needleless syringe with an injection solution for injection to a patient. The inline dry drug modules include a dry drug storage component for storing a dry drug dosage and a uniform carrier liquid distribution component for promoting uniform contact of the dry drug storage component by the carrier liquid to form an injection solution from the dry drug dosage. The inline dry drug modules can include a discrete dry drug storage component and a discrete uniform carrier liquid distribution component or a dual purpose component for both drug storage and uniform carrier liquid distribution. The vial adapters can be provided in vented or non-vented versions.Type: ApplicationFiled: May 5, 2014Publication date: March 24, 2016Applicant: MEDIMOP MEDICAL PROJECTS LTD.Inventors: Hugh Zachary MARKS, Nimrod LEV, Amir LEV

Publication number: 20150034024Abstract: Modern steam generators typically include a radiant section and a convection section. Due to differing performance requirements of the radiant and convection sections, the radiant section often has a round cross-section, while the convection section often has a rectangular cross-section. Previous designs utilized a target wall to effect the transition. An angled transition section is disclosed herein that substantially eliminates the target wall and/or the reverse target and provides a corresponding improvement in steam generator efficiency.Type: ApplicationFiled: September 12, 2013Publication date: February 5, 2015Applicants: Aera Energy LLC, PCL Industrial Services, Inc.Inventors: Garry Loren Barker, Mark Elmer Pittser, Zachary Mark Smith

Patent number: 8880799Abstract: A rebuilder application operates on a dispersed data storage grid and rebuilds stored data segments that have been compromised in some manner. The rebuilder application actively scans for compromised data segments, and is also notified during partially failed writes to the dispersed data storage network, and during reads from the dispersed data storage network when a data slice is detected that is compromised. Records are created for compromised data segments, and put into a rebuild list, which the rebuilder application processes.Type: GrantFiled: March 31, 2008Date of Patent: November 4, 2014Assignee: Cleversafe, Inc.Inventors: Lynn Foster, Jason Resch, Ilya Volvovski, John Quigley, Greg Dhuse, Vance Thornton, Dusty Hendrickson, Zachary Mark

Patent number: 8370329Abstract: Suggested search results are provided with suggested search queries as a user incrementally enters characters of a search query. At each incremental user input, a query portion is received and suggested search queries are identified based on the query portion. Suggested search results associated with the suggested search queries are also identified. These suggested search results enable direct navigation to web sites associated with the search results. In some embodiments, a user's search history is analyzed to identify search results selected by the user for the suggested search queries. In other embodiments, search histories for a group of users associated with the user are analyzed to identify the suggested search results to provide with the suggested search queries.Type: GrantFiled: September 22, 2008Date of Patent: February 5, 2013Assignee: Microsoft CorporationInventors: Zachary Mark Gutt, Richard Leigh Mains, Anastasia Paushkina
